Elevated chromium, molybdenum, and nitrogen contents driving corrosion resistance

Super duplex 2507 stainless steel owes its remarkable resilience in marine settings to its unique chemical composition, in which elevated levels of chromium, molybdenum, and nitrogen play critical roles. Chromium imparts a strong passive oxide film that guards against corrosion, while molybdenum enhances resistance to pitting and crevice corrosion, common threats in chloride-rich seawater. Nitrogen contributes to both corrosion resistance and mechanical strength by stabilizing the austenitic phase within the alloy's microstructure. Comparison with standard stainless steels like 304 and 316

Standard stainless steels such as 304 and 316 have long been favored for their corrosion resistance and availability; however, their performance in challenging marine conditions falls short compared to super duplex 2507. While 316 stainless steel contains molybdenum improving resistance over 304, both grades are vulnerable to localized corrosion when exposed to high chloride concentrations. Industrial fasteners manufacturers highlight that super duplex 2507’s balanced duplex structure offers nearly twice the yield strength of these conventional grades, supporting better mechanical stability under heavy loads. Additionally, the Pitting Resistance Equivalent Number (PREN) of super duplex 2507 exceeds 40, a threshold far beyond the capabilities of 304 or 316, making it a preferred choice in subsea, offshore oil, and desalination industries. Advantages of “fit and forget” reliability without secondary coatings

One of the most valued attributes of super duplex 2507 fasteners supplied by industrial fasteners manufacturers and trusted nickel alloy fastener suppliers is their capability to provide “fit and forget” reliability. These fasteners do not require secondary coatings or surface treatments that often degrade or necessitate repeated maintenance in aggressive marine conditions. The alloy’s intrinsic corrosion resistance, combined with meticulous manufacturing techniques such as cold heading and hot forging, preserve strength and surface integrity over time. This reduces operational disruption and fatigue for engineers and maintenance teams, as inspection intervals can be extended and unplanned replacements minimized. Moreover, the high strength-to-weight ratio of super duplex 2507 fasteners allows designers to reduce the size or quantity of fasteners needed, which positively impacts the overall weight and cost-efficiency of offshore platforms.
